we do most of our streaming using the free (as in speech and beer)
ogg vorbis codec, our stream
server is icecast. many other
software solutions (other than the ones mentioned above) can be found
here, including the spiffy
VLC, or you can try the
WXDU-only java player, both of
which work on most platforms out there.
